- Abstract: Intercropping and the application of organic manure are important approaches for increasing of quantity and quality of plant products. In this experiment, chemical compositions and antioxidant activity of dill essential oil in sole crop and dill-soybean intercropping system under organic manure and chemical fertilizers were evaluated. The results showed that optimal yield of dill and the highest land equivalent ratio (LER) and antioxidant activity (2.43 μg ml −1 ) of dill were achieved in pattern of two rows of soybean + one row of dill treated with organic manure. Carvone (22.06–49.66%), α-phellandrene (10.79–34.49%), p-cymene (21.66–33.69%) and dillapiole (1.35–12.14%) were major chemical components of dill. The dill-soybean intercropping and application of organic manure enhanced the content of α-phellandrene and p-cymene as well. These major chemical compositions are useful for industrial use (food and pharmaceutical). So, according to different subjects of applying in industries it could be suggested especial treatment with favorite major compounds. In general, soybean-dill intercropping and the application of organic manure enhanced the productivity of dill and improved essential oil quality and antioxidant activity.
